Hmmm... Five good industrial Cds eh? Well... For starters I would reccomend anything by 'Skinny Puppy' they're one of the big names in the scene for sure, my two favorite albums by them are called "too dark park" (older) and "the process" (newer). They have a number of very awesome side projects if you decide you like them such as: Doubting Thomas, The Tear Garden, Download, OhGr, Ritalin, and Cevin Key, among others.
Ok... number 2: The Very Best of My Life With the Thrill Kill Kult... they will introduce you to the wonderful world of lounge/swing *aka silly-ass* industrial music, its good fun. If you like it, try bands like KMFDM, Pig and Pigface, they all have the same fun/funky electronic sound of goodness!
Numero Three: Anything by the band Psychic TV, they practically started the whole dang scene with a side project called Throbbing Gristle. Genesis P. Orridge is their front man/woman (s/he's a bit of both these days) and my personal hero, i suggest to you the albums 'Pagan Day' or 'Force thee Hand of Chance'... both very very good.
Hmmm... moving right along to number 4... try 'PRICK' for a more mainstream guitar influenced, Nine Inch Nails type sound, their lead singer Kevin McMahon was buddies with Trent Reznor back in the day and you'll probably notice that heavily in their self-titled album. While it's not industrial so much as it is electro-inspired rock, its still a personal favorite.
And for number 5... ummm. Damn there's so much good stuff out there!! Well, a shameless plug for another of my favorites, try "Pop Will Eat Itself" also known as "PWEI" or "Poppies", they're hilarious and seriously old school industrial.
